* { margin: 0; padding: 0;}
html{ height: 100%; }
body{ position:  relative; min-height: 100%; background: #white; color: black; margin: 0; padding: 0}
body.ie6 {height: 100%;}
body.ie {text-align: left;}

body {
   font-family:Arial,Helvetica,sans-serif;
}

#top {position: absolute; left: 0; top: 0; width: 100%;}
#bottom {position: absolute; left: 0; bottom: 0px; height: 130px; width: 100%;}

.quatro #contentblock {padding-bottom: 135px; padding-top: 350px;}

#contentblock {padding-bottom: 135px; padding-top: 260px;}
#contentblock {width: 100%; clear: both; overflow: none; text-align: justify}

/* column container */
.colmask {
	clear:both;
	float:left;
	width:100%;
	overflow:hidden;
}
/* common column settings */
.colright,
.colmid,
.colleft {
	float:left;
	width:100%;
	position:relative;
}
.col1,
.col2,
.col3 {
	float:left;
	position:relative;
	padding:.5em 0 1em 0;
	overflow:display;
}
/* 2 Column (left menu) settings */
.leftmenu {
	background:none;		/* right column background colour */
}
.leftmenu .colleft {
	right:75%;				/* right column width */
	background:none;		/* left column background colour */
}
.leftmenu .col1 {
	width:75%;				/* right column content width */
	left:98%;				/* 100% plus left column left padding */
}
.leftmenu .col2 {
	width:240px;				/* left column content width (column width minus left and right padding) */
	left:1%;				/* (right column left and right padding) plus (left column left padding) */
}

.ie6 img, .ie6 .png{
position:relative;
behavior: expression((this.runtimeStyle.behavior="none")&&(this.pngSet?this.pngSet=true:(this.nodeName == "IMG" && this.src.toLowerCase().indexOf('.png')>-1?(this.runtimeStyle.backgroundImage = "none",
this.runtimeStyle.filter = "progid:DXImageTransform.Microsoft.AlphaImageLoader(src='" + this.src + "', sizingMethod='image')",
this.src = "/i/ic/transparent.gif"):(this.origBg = this.origBg? this.origBg :this.currentStyle.backgroundImage.toString().replace('url("','').replace('")',''),
this.runtimeStyle.filter = "progid:DXImageTransform.Microsoft.AlphaImageLoader(src='" + this.origBg + "', sizingMethod='crop')",
this.runtimeStyle.backgroundImage = "none")),this.pngSet=true)
);
}

#copyright {
    color:#8B8A89;
    font-family:Arial !important;
    font-size:12px !important;
    font-size-adjust:none;
    font-stretch:normal;
    font-style:normal;
    font-variant:normal;
    font-weight:normal;
    line-height:normal;
    vertical-align:top;
    height: 32px;
}


#copyright a {
    font-family:Arial !important;
    font-size:12px !important;
}

#copyright a:active {
    color: #a00000 !important;
}

#copyright td {vertical-align:top !important;}

#admin-icons td {
    padding: 2px !important;
    vertical-align:middle !important;
    border: 0 !important;
}

label {color: #767676}


table td {border: 0}

#bottom table {margin: 0; padding: 0; border: 0}
#bottom table tr {margin: 0; padding: 0; border: 0}
#bottom table td {margin: 0; padding: 0; border: 0; vertical-align: bottom;}
#bottom img, #bottom p {margin: 0; padding: 0; border: 0}

#top {overflow: hidden; height: 266px}
.quatro #top {height: 348px}
#top table tr td {padding: 0}
#top table tr th {padding: 0}
#top img {padding: 0; margin: 0}

#rotator{
    position:absolute;
    top:160px;
    background: url(/quatro/im/rotator.gif) no-repeat;
    width : 250px;
    height : 100px;
    left : 20px;
}

.quatro #rotator{
    top:180px;
}

#logo{
position:absolute;
top:14px;
width : 230px;
height : 95px;
left : 20px;
}

#logo img {
z-index : 10;
}
#logo span {
    position:absolute;
    z-index: -10;
}

#menu {
    position : absolute;
    left : 0px;
    top : 231px;
    width: 100%;
    height:34px;
}

.quatro #menu {
    top : 312px;
}

#nav_menu {
    background-color : #a20100;
    float : left;
    width : 100%;
    #margin-right : -1px;
}

#navigation_container {
    position : absolute;
    right : 10px;
    top : 210px;
    vertical-align : middle;
    z-index: 4;
}

#navigation_container img {margin: 0}

.quatro #navigation_container {
    top : 290px;
}

#m1 {
    width : 17%;
    height : 37px;
    margin-bottom : -3px;
    float : left;
}

#m2 {
background: url(/quatro/im/2.gif) no-repeat;
width : 20%;
float:left;
height : 34px;
margin-bottom : -3px;

}

#m3 {
background: url(/quatro/im/3.gif) no-repeat;
float:left;
width : 17%;
height : 34px;
    margin-bottom : -3px;
}

#m4 {
background: url(/quatro/im/4.gif) no-repeat;
float:left;
width : 18%;
height : 34px;
    margin-bottom : -3px;
}

#m5 {
background: url(/quatro/im/5.gif) no-repeat;
float:left;
width : 14%;
margin-bottom : -3px;
#margin-right : -1px;
height : 34px;
}

#m6 {
background: url(/quatro/im/6.gif) no-repeat;
float:left;
width : 14%;
margin-bottom : -3px;
#margin-right : -1px;
height : 34px;
}

#search {
    float:left;
    width : 204px;
    height : 34px;
    background-color : #FFFFFF;
    display:inline;
    position : absolute;
    left : 20px;
    top : 313px;
}

.s_pole  {
    border-style: solid;
    border-width : 1px;
    border-color : #cccccc;
}

#footer_left{
    width:550px;
    float : left;
    height:130px;
    background: url(/quatro/im/footer_left.png) no-repeat;
    margin : 0px;
    padding : 0px;
    margin-right : -3px;
}




#footer_center{
    height:130px;
    margin : 0px;
    margin-right : 122px;
    background-image: url(/quatro/im/footer_repeat.gif);
    background-repeat : repeat-x;
}

#f_text_about{
    margin-top: 67px;
    margin-left: 311px;
    #margin-left : 156px;
    float:left;
}

#f_text_about_itg_i {
    width : 28px;
    height : 28px;

    background-image : url(/quatro/im/itg.jpg);
    margin-top: 10px;
    margin-left: 558px;
}

#f_text_about_itg{
    height : 28px;
    width : 250px;
    text-align : right;
}

#footer_line{
    width:305px;
    margin-left: 494px;
    height:4px;
    background: url(/quatro/im/line.gif) repeat-x;
}

#content .error {padding: 0;}
#content .error p {padding: 10px}

.tableble th, td {padding: 0;}

.text_block a img, .text_block img {
    padding: 3px;
    border: 3px double #BABABA;
    border-width: 3px;
    border-style: double;
    border-color: #BABABA;
    margin: 6px;	
}

#content .text_block img.header {padding: 0px; border: 0px}
#content a img {margin: 0}

div.hierarchy {margin-bottom:0.8em;font-family:Tahoma;font-size:11px;color:#ADADAD;}
body.NOie div.hierarchy {margin-top: 3px}

div.hierarchy a {color:#ADADAD}
div.hierarchy a:hover {}
div.hierarchy a {font-family:Tahoma;font-size:11px;}
div.hierarchy span {display:none;}

#left_menu {
    margin-left:25px;
    margin-right : 20px;
    #margin-left:1%;
    margin-top: 120px;

    float : left;
}

.quatro #left_menu {
    margin-top: 20px;
}

#left_menu li {
    margin-bottom : 2px;
}

#left_menu a {
    font-family:Arial,Helvetica,sans-serif;
    font-size:12px;
    font-weight: bold;
}

#left_menu img {margin: 0}

#newbie_left {
    margin-top : 48px;
    width : 249px;
    height : 309px;
    background : url(/quatro/im/newbie_left.jpg);
}

.img_red_marker {
    float:left;
    margin-top:6px;

}

#block_2_sub_vtor {
margin-left:78px;
}

.text_block {
    margin-left : 7px;
    color:#767676;
    font-family:Arial,Helvetica,sans-serif;
    font-size:12px;
}

#content .text_block {
    text-indent: 45px;
}

#content .noindent {
    text-indent: 0px;
}

h1 {
    color : #a20100;
    font-size : 14px;
    margin-top : 0px;
    margin-bottom : 12px;
    font-weight : bold;
}

#content h1 {
    margin-bottom : 0px;
}

.text_block ul {
    margin-left: 45px;
}

.text_block li {
    text-indent: 0px;
    color : #a20100;
}


.text_block h3 {
    text-indent: 0px;
    color : #a20100;
    font-size : 12px;
    font-weight: bold;
    margin-bottom: 0px;
}
.text_block h2 {
    text-indent: 0px;
    color : #a20100;
    font-size : 12px;
    font-weight: bold;
    margin-bottom: 0px;
}




a {
    color : #a20100;
    text-decoration :underline;
    font-weight : bold;
    font-size : 12px;
}

a:hover {
    color : #a00000;
}

a:active {
    color : #a00000;
}

a .visited {
    color : #a20100;
    text-decoration :underline;
}

ul {
 list-style-type: none;
 line-height: 2;
 margin-left: 20px;
 list-style-image: url(/quatro/im/str2.gif);
}

#left_menu ul {margin-top: 0; padding-top: 0; padding-bottom: 0;}

ul li a {}
